Student Green Team

As an active participant in the King County Green Schools Program, Einstein’s Green Team, known as the Green Otters, works to support students, teachers, staff, and parents in creating a healthy school and community environment. Our mission is to inspire meaningful change within our school and beyond by nurturing thoughtful learners, reducing our environmental footprint, and cultivating collaboration, student voice, and strong leadership to make a positive impact.

This program is available for students in 3rd, 4th and 5th grade who are interested in being a Green Community Leader.

Participants will:

  • Attend monthly Green Team meetings. 
  • Learn about and model “green behavior” at school and in the community.
  • Help plan, organize and participate in Earth Week activities (April).
  • Learn about food waste reduction, and from time to time, help during lunch
    time to sort food waste.
  • Learn ways to save energy and conserve water.
  • Help take care of the school garden.

Application process: Anyone in grades 3-5 must submit an application form (registration for 2025-2026 is now closed).

Applicants' families are contacted by email by the end of September or beginning of October.
